What is Ventilator Support? Debunking the Essentials for New Nurses

Ventilator support describes the use of mechanical tools to aid or change spontaneous breathing in individuals who can not breathe effectively by themselves. This can occur due to different clinical problems such as respiratory system failing, persistent obstructive pulmonary illness (COPD), or serious pneumonia.

Understanding Mechanical Ventilation

Mechanical air flow can be identified right into two primary categories: invasive and non-invasive approaches. Intrusive air flow entails the insertion of an endotracheal tube or tracheostomy tube, whereas non-invasive ventilation utilizes masks or nasal devices to provide air.

Invasive vs Non-Invasive Ventilation

    Invasive Ventilation:
      Requires intubation. More efficient for serious respiratory system distress. Higher risk of complications such as infections and trauma.
    Non-Invasive Ventilation:
      Often made use of for much less extreme cases. Lower danger of complications. Can be unpleasant for patients.

Key Parts of Ventilator Support

A ventilator operates via several key components:

Modes of Ventilation: Different modes like Assist-Control (A/C), Synchronized Recurring Necessary Ventilation (SIMV), and Stress Support (PS) deal with different patient needs.

Settings: Setups such as tidal volume, respiratory price, and FiO2 are adjusted based upon individual patient requirements.

image

Monitoring: Continual surveillance of vital indications and blood gases is crucial for efficient management.

Ventilator Pressure Assistance: A Vital Mode

One prominent mode used during mechanical air flow is Stress Assistance (PS). It enables people more control over their breathing while still receiving essential support from the machine.

How Stress Support Works

In Stress Assistance setting, the ventilator delivers a pre-programmed quantity of pressure throughout breathing while permitting clients to start breaths automatically:

Reduces work-of-breathing compared to regulated modes. Ideal for weaning people off mechanical aid gradually.

Advantages & & Disadvantages

|Benefits|Drawbacks|| --------------------------------------|-------------------------------------|| Enhanced convenience due to spontaneity|Risk of hypoventilation if badly monitored|

FAQs Concerning Ventilator Support

1. What prevail signs for initiating ventilator support?

Ventilator assistance may be indicated in situations such as acute respiratory distress disorder (ARDS), COPD exacerbation, or post-operative healing where spontaneous breathing is insufficient.

2 What training do nurses require prior to running a ventilator?

Nurses ought to complete official training such as fundamental ventilator courses that consist of both theory regarding mechanical concepts alongside hands-on practice.

3 Exactly how do you determine appropriate settings on a ventilator?

Settings need to be embellished based upon person analysis data consisting of tidal quantity computations originated from ideal body weight together with clinician judgment based upon arterial blood gas results.

4 What's the distinction in between invasive and non-invasive ventilation?

While invasive needs intubation (placing tubes inside air passages), non-invasive utilizes masks or nasal tools without getting in respiratory tracts directly.

5 What role does family education and learning play when handling clients on vents?

Educating households allows them better involvement during care procedures making certain emotional assistance while boosting understanding concerning decision-making bordering treatment plans.

6 Exist threats connected with long term mechanical ventilation?

Yes! Extended use may lead threat elements consisting of infections (ventilator-associated pneumonia), muscular tissue weakness from disuse along various other difficulties requiring cautious tracking by nursing staff.
